The Bunny The Bear is an American post hardcore band from Buffalo, New York. Formed in 2008 by Matthew Tybor, also referred to as "The Bunny" hence the rabbit mask and persona he incorporates in the group. Tybor was immediately joined by Chris Hutka, known as "The Bear" whom likewise, wears a bear mask. Tybor employs screamed vocals for the band while Hutka provides clean vocals. Tybor also writes all music and lyrics for the band. The band was signed to Victory Records in February of 2011.

History

The Bunny The Bear self released their debut self-titled album on February 4, 2010. They released a music video for the song entitled "April 11" on June 8, 2010.[1] In December 2010, the band released a music video for a new demo song called "Aisle".[2] The music video caught the attention of independent music label Victory Records, who signed the band in 2011. The band's latest album, If You Don't Have Anything Nice To Say, was released on June 28, 2011.[3]

Recently, the band toured with various artists such as The Scenery, Funeral For a Friend, Escape The Fate, The Amity Affliction, Deception Of A Ghost, This Day Will Tell, and label mates Victorian Halls to promote the release of If You Don't Have Anything Nice To Say. By the end of the summer, the band added Danny Stillman (Drop Dead, Gorgeous) to run triggers and electronics live and replaced Brian Dietz with a new drummer.

Members

Current members
  • Matthew Tybor (The Bunny) - unclean vocals (2008–present)
  • Chris Hutka (The Bear) - clean vocals, unclean vocals (2008–present)
  • Erik Kogut - guitar (2009–present)
  • Matt Trozzi - drums (2011–present)
  • Steve Drachenberg - bass guitar (2008–2009, 2011–present)
  • Amber Kogut - guitar, backing vocals (2011–present)
  • Danny Stillman - keyboards, synth (2011–present)
Past members
  • Mike Toczek Jr. - guitar (2008–2009)
  • Jim Kaczmarski - drums (2008–2010)
  • Chris Cole - guitar (2009–2010)
  • Derek Anthony - bass guitar (2009–2011)
  • Brian Dietz - drums (2010–2011)
